Community Sentiment Pulse — Ylang 49
Mixed
18 opinions · Source: r/fragrance community
6.5
/10
Ylang 49 is a divisive fragrance with strong opinions in both directions. The community appreciates its modern chypre composition and unique floral-earthiness, but notes that its patchouli-forward profile and earthy, somewhat dated character make it not universally appealing. Best suited for fragrance adventurers who enjoy intense florals and earthy notes rather than mainstream audiences.
Positive
Unique and interesting composition with strong floral-chypre character
Excellent longevity and projection
Great for those who love ylang ylang, gardenia, and oakmoss notes
Negative
Patchouli-forward which may be off-putting for patchouli-sensitive wearers
Polarizing scent with a love-it-or-hate-it quality
Department store aesthetic that some find dated or old-fashioned
Community Sentiment Pulse — Santal 33
Mixed
95 opinions · Source: r/fragrance community
6.5
/10
Santal 33 is a highly polarizing fragrance with passionate fans and equally strong detractors. While those who love it praise its woody, creamy sandalwood character, the community consensus warns against wearing it to professional settings due to its extreme projection and divisive scent profile that many perceive as pickle-like or overly synthetic. It remains a popular but controversial choice best reserved for personal enjoyment outside the workplace.
Positive
Beautiful, creamy sandalwood scent with excellent longevity (8-10 hours)
Highly divisive but beloved by fans who appreciate its woody profile
High-quality niche fragrance from respected house Le Labo
Negative
Extremely strong projection and sillage - smellable from a block away
Many people perceive pickle, dill, pencil shavings, or antiseptic notes instead of pleasant wood
